Chicken Scampi Recipe

Ingredients:

1 lb boneless chicken breasts, cut into 1" strips (chicken tenderloins work well here)
1/4 cup egg beaters
1/3 cup Italian bread crumbs
3 tbsp. olive oil
2 tbsp. butter
3 garlic cloves, chopped
1 cup fat free chicken broth
2/3 cup dry white wine
1 1/2 tbsp. chopped parsley
1/4 tsp. oregano
1/8 tsp. salt
pinch cayenne pepper
shredded parmesan cheese

Directions:

Dip chicken in egg, then in bread crumbs. In large skillet heat olive oil. Add chicken and saute about about 6 minutes until browned. Remove chicken to plate.
Add butter and garlic and saute 1 minute. Add rest of ingredients and bring to a boil. Add chicken.
Simmer 10-15 minutes until cooked through.
Serve over cooked garlic roasted fettucine, brown rice or couscous. Sprinkle with parmesan cheese.
